INTRODUCTION Photographs and other images of the Earth taken from the air and from space show a great deal about the planet's landforms, vegetation, and resources. Aerial and satellite images, known as remotely sensed images, permit accurate mapping of land cover and make landscape features understandable on regional, continental, and even global scales. Transient phenomena, such as seasonal vegetation vigor and contaminant discharges, can be studied by comparing images acquired at different times. Satellites, including manned spacecraft, usually collect images from hundreds of miles above the Earth's surface while aircrafts operate at altitudes ranging from a few thousand to about 60,000 feet above the terrain. In general, the level of detail is greater in low-altitude photographs that cover relatively small areas, while satellite images cover much larger areas but show less detail. Some important terms and their definitions: Stereogram: A stereogram is any image that, through one of several techniques (e.g. parallel view or cross-eyed view methods), is able to convey the experience of depth perception to the viewer. Stereoscope: A stereoscope is a device for viewing stereogram that contains two separate images that are printed sideby-side to create the illusion of a three-dimensional image. Topographic map: is a detailed and accurate graphic representation of cultural and natural features (such as relief, usually using contour lines) on the ground. Contour lines: Are lines in a topographic map that connect all points that have the same elevation above sea level.
